Pork

From shoulder to loin. Pork browns hard in circulating heat. Fatty cuts self-baste; lean chops need oil and timing.

In the air fryer. Score fat caps. Pull chops a few degrees early and rest. They climb while sitting.

Nutrition

Typical values per 100g raw loin

143kcal

Protein
21g
Fat
6g
Carbs
0g

Approximate kitchen reference. Not a lab label. Brands and cuts vary.

Origin

Domestic pig (Sus scrofa domesticus), central to East Asian, European, Latin American, and Southern U.S. kitchens.

Herbal & culinary notes

Rich in thiamine (B1). Choose leaner cuts for everyday plates; save shoulder for shredding.

How to store

Fresh chops/roasts: fridge 3-5 days; ground pork 1-2 days. Freeze steaks/roasts up to 6 months, ground 3-4 months.

Food safety

Cook whole cuts to 145°F (63°C) with a 3-minute rest. Ground pork to 160°F (71°C).

Food hazards

Historically linked to Trichinella (rare in commercial US/EU pork) and Toxoplasma. Proper cooking remains the control. Keep raw pork separate from salads.
